Sylvia Hotel & Resort Komodo
3.9/5183 Reviews
We booked two nights and stayed 6 nights. Contrary to most hotels, Sylvia hotel is situated at a nice stretch of beach. Around high tide there is excellent snorkelling right from the beach. The rooms and beds are comfortable. The staff is friendly and helpful. It is quiet and most room have a terrace with sea view. The price quality is excellent. The only negative site is that it is 5 km from Labuan Bayo centre and the only transport is a taxi or the irregular hotel shuttle bus at taxi price. There only a few Indonesian and Italian dishes on the menu. The service at the restaurant is slow. There are no other restaurant at walking distance.

Sudamala Resort, Seraya, Flores
3.8/553 Reviews
Our experience at this resort was amazing. It's very intimate, only about 30 rooms, so a perfect place to relax. We had a Private Beach Bungalow, every room has its own sunbeds and umbrella just outside the room on the beach. The room was very nice, simple yet elegant, with all amenities. The bathroom has an outdoor shower, at first I was a bit worried about insects but we didn't see many. The staff was very kind and efficient, we had turndown every night. We used the laundry service and it was super quick. The restaurant is good, all meals are a la carte including breakfast. I do prefer buffet breakfasts, but I have to say the menu had a lot of options and everything was very good quality (cappuccino was really good and they had freshly squeezed juice). They do not have a half board or full board option, so lunch and dinner are extras (you can choose to have breakfast included in room price). We found that western food options were actually better than Indonesian ones. The sunset bar was also a nice plus. My husband also used the diving centre and he was very happy. The snorkeling in the house reef was very good, we did not do any excursions because we had been on a liveaboard on the days before our stay. One small downside is that because of the tides for a certain number of hours every day (the high tide happens at different times every day) you cannot really swim from the beach, so you need to go from the jetty. Overall I would definitely recommend.
Komodo Lodge
4.3/593 Reviews
We stayed in this hotel for one night either side of our Liveaboard trip (so two nights). It’s cheap and extremely accessible for the port, so idea if you just want somewhere to sleep either side. However, the basic and superior rooms are almost entirely two different hotels. We initially booked basic, as the pictures looked fine, but these rooms were terrible. Incredibly small and dark, filled with mosquitos, shower didn’t work properly and the room was incredibly loud at night and right until the early hours because of the strangest disco which seemed to only have like 4 people in attendance but still played all night. After complaining about our room and asking to be moved to the new building for the second night of our stay (when we returned from our Liveaboard), where all the rooms were the superior ones, it was like a completely different hotel. Room was much nicer and all the issues were resolved. The price difference between the two was only small, so just don’t even consider staying unless you book the superior room. Breakfast was fine, fairly basic and nothing to get excited about, but good enough. Music over breakfast was strangely loud though.
